Method listMetricNames

Retrieves the list of metric names.

HTTP request

GET https://monitoring.api.cloud.yandex.net/monitoring/v2/metrics/names

Query parameters

Parameter Description
folderId Required. ID of the folder that the metric belongs to. The maximum string length in characters is 50.
selectors Metric selectors.
nameFilter Substring name filter text.
pageSize Maximum number of metrics in response. 0 means default page size = 30, maximum page size = 10000.
pageToken Page token. To get the next page of results, set pageToken to the nextPageToken returned by a previous list request.

Response

HTTP Code: 200 - OK

{
  "names": [
    "string"
  ],
  "nextPageToken": "string"
}
Field Description
names[] string

List of metric names.

nextPageToken string

This token allows you to get the next page of results for list requests.
